Metal alkoxides - models for metal oxides. 9. Hydridoditungsten alkoxides: W/sub 2/(H)(O-i-Pr)/sub 8/Na diglyme and W/sub 2/(H)(I)(OCH/sub 2/-t-Bu)/sub 6/(H/sub 2/NMe). Further investigations of the reaction between W/sub 2/(NMe/sub 2/)/sub 6/(M identical with M) and i-PrOH leading to W/sub 3/(H)/sub 2/(O-i-Pr)/sub 14/

Journal Article · · J. Am. Chem. Soc.; (United States)
DOI:https://doi.org/10.1021/ja00262a007· OSTI ID:6038273

Reaction between W/sub 2/(NMe/sub 2/)/sub 6/(M identical with M) and i-PrOH (>>6 equiv), which leads to the known compound W/sub 4/(H)/sub 2/(O-i-Pr)/sub 14/, is shown to be critically dependent on the presence of the liberated amine. The addition of i-PrOH (>>6 equiv) to hydrocarbon solutions of W/sub 2/(O-t-Bu)/sub 6/ or W/sub 2/(O-i-Pr)/sub 6/(HNMe/sub 2/)/sub 2/ does not lead to W/sub 4/(H)/sub 2/(O-i-Pr)/sub 14/ but rather yields an oliomeric species (W(O-i-Pr)/sub 3/)/sub n/. From the reaction between W/sub 2/(O-t-Bu)/sub 6/ in hexane/ROH and NaOR (1 equiv), hexane-insoluble compounds are formed: NaW/sub 2/(H)(OR)/sub 8/, where R = i-Pr and CH/sub 2/-t-Bu. Extraction into hexane solution by the addition of diglyme (1 equiv) yields W/sub 2/(H)(O-i-Pr)/sub 8/Na diglyme, which has been characterized by NMR studies and a single-crystal X-ray diffraction study. Crystal data for W/sub 2/(H)(O-i-Pr)/sub 8/Na diglyme at -155 /sup 0/C are the following: a = 24.087 (8) A, b = 16.540 (5) A, c = 12.747 (4) A, ..beta.. = 125.71 (1)/sup 0/, Z = 4,d/sub calcd/ = 1.608 g cm/sup -3/, and space group P2/sub 1//a; for W/sub 2/(H)(I)(OCH/sub 2/-t-Bu)/sub 6/(H/sub 2/NMe) at -158 /sup 0/C a = 18.159 (5) A, b = 10.873 (2) A, c = 11.599 (3) A, ..cap alpha.. = 77.30 (1)/sup 0/, ..beta.. = 109.37 (1)/sup 0/, ..gamma.. = 96.55 (2)/sup 0/, Z = 2,d/sub calcd/ = 1.656 g cm/sup -3/, and space group P1. 31 references, 7 figures, 7 tables.
